Understanding Common Hot Water Issues
Hot water is an essential part of our daily lives, so when issues arise, prompt attention is crucial. Common problems include temperature regulation failures, leaking heaters, and pressure buildup. These plumbing issues can be frustrating and may lead to wastage of resources or even safety hazards if not addressed timely.
Understanding the root causes of these problems is key to efficient repairs. For instance, a malfunctioning thermostat could be the culprit behind inconsistent water temperatures. Leaks often indicate worn-out seals or valves that require replacement. Meanwhile, pressure issues might demand professional assessment for potential clogs or system imbalances. Efficient hot water repair services focus on diagnosing and rectifying these issues swiftly, ensuring residents or business owners can get back to their routines without disruption.

Maintenance Tips to Prevent Future Issues
Regular maintenance is key to avoiding costly and inconvenient hot water repairs. Start by inspecting your water heater for any signs of corrosion, leaks, or unusual noise. These issues can often be resolved with simple plumbing fixes, like tightening connections or replacing worn-out parts. Scheduling annual check-ups with a professional plumber is also highly recommended, as they can identify potential problems before they escalate.
In addition to professional inspections, there are several DIY steps you can take to maintain your water heater. Flushing the tank periodically removes sediment buildup, ensuring optimal performance and extending its lifespan. Keep an eye on energy usage, as sudden spikes could indicate efficiency issues or leaks. Promptly addressing any unusual behaviors will prevent more serious plumbing problems down the line.
Modern Technologies in Hot Water Systems
Modern technologies have significantly enhanced hot water systems, offering faster and more efficient repairs compared to traditional methods. One notable advancement is the integration of smart plumbing systems that utilize IoT (Internet of Things) devices. These innovative solutions allow plumbers to diagnose issues remotely by monitoring system performance in real-time. With data-driven insights, technicians can promptly identify problems, saving valuable time during service calls.
Additionally, advanced materials and designs are revolutionizing hot water heaters. Insulated tanks, for instance, reduce heat loss, ensuring faster heating times and improved energy efficiency. These technological improvements not only benefit homeowners with quicker, more convenient repairs but also contribute to sustainable plumbing practices by minimizing energy consumption.
